I use Granola, I’m not affiliated with them. They create detailed meeting notes from whatever I type during the meeting, it uses the transcript and AI to flesh out my notes. It’s a great idea and their tiering is nice. 25 meetings free iirc. I sometimes chat with past meetings and find it useful to deep dive into the narratives.<p>The bigger issue I have is to do with messaging and clientele-communication itself.
